Output 17668433d9f8001fc7e75edb932bd6f33f1065de03be63e6f98068b834bd9922:0

value
850538
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86082fb40f445f02cdebcd0e783037a1eb9482f6 OP_EQUAL
address
3DuiH3cy6WjZWN3p93ZXeX5nLWr7Wi69bP
transaction
17668433d9f8001fc7e75edb932bd6f33f1065de03be63e6f98068b834bd9922
spent
true